Skip to content

Commit 7407bbd

Browse files
authored
Merge pull request #2630 from appwrite/fix-alignment
2 parents a5c9df2 + 9e8c3e2 commit 7407bbd

File tree

3 files changed

+12
-5
lines changed

3 files changed

+12
-5
lines changed

src/lib/components/emptyCardImageCloud.svelte

Lines changed: 10 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,13 +1,20 @@
1-
<script>
2-
import { getNextTier, tierToPlan } from '$lib/stores/billing';
1+
<script lang="ts">
2+
import { isSmallViewport } from '$lib/stores/viewport';
33
import { organization } from '$lib/stores/organization';
4+
import { getNextTier, tierToPlan } from '$lib/stores/billing';
45
import { Card, Layout, Typography } from '@appwrite.io/pink-svelte';
56
67
export let source = 'empty_state_card';
8+
export let responsive = false;
9+
10+
// type def for Layout.Stack!
11+
let direction: 'column' | 'row' | 'row-reverse' | 'column-reverse' = 'row';
12+
13+
$: direction = responsive ? ($isSmallViewport ? 'column' : 'row') : 'row';
714
</script>
815

916
<Card.Base variant="secondary" padding="s" radius="s">
10-
<Layout.Stack direction="row" gap="l">
17+
<Layout.Stack {direction} gap="l">
1118
{#if $$slots?.image}
1219
<div style="flex-shrink:0">
1320
<slot name="image" />

src/routes/(console)/project-[region]-[project]/auth/security/updateMockNumbers.svelte

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-95,7 +95,7 @@
9595
Learn more</Link.Anchor>
9696
<svelte:fragment slot="aside">
9797
{#if isComponentDisabled}
98-
<EmptyCardImageCloud source="email_signature_card">
98+
<EmptyCardImageCloud responsive source="email_signature_card">
9999
<svelte:fragment slot="image">
100100
<div class=" is-only-mobile u-width-full-line u-height-100-percent">
101101
{#if $app.themeInUse === 'dark'}

src/routes/(console)/project-[region]-[project]/auth/templates/emailSignature.svelte

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,7 @@
1515
Enable or disable Appwrite branding in your email template signature.
1616

1717
<svelte:fragment slot="aside">
18-
<EmptyCardImageCloud source="email_signature_card" let:nextTier>
18+
<EmptyCardImageCloud responsive source="email_signature_card" let:nextTier>
1919
<svelte:fragment slot="image">
2020
<div class=" is-only-mobile u-width-full-line u-height-100-percent">
2121
{#if $app.themeInUse === 'dark'}

0 commit comments

Comments
 (0)